Beacon Hill is a hamlet in 62-25-W3, Saskatchewan, Canada. It is classified as a village / hamlet. Beacon Hill is located at 54.3501°N, 109.6508°W.
Beacon Hill rises gently from the vast, rolling plains, its low slopes a subtle swell against the immense Saskatchewan sky. It lies 35.2 km east-south-east of Cold Lake, SK (from Cold Lake, SK: bearing 108°T), and is situated 8.3 km east of Pierceland.
